Output 5cd61a3f6fba80c6f6b91ac63188c050dd31e82396304b590a8b864a51b43df9:5

value
1086165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6c19ec4b4b9f18f1a48feb567cf48be3a1282aa OP_EQUAL
address
3Nj9Hda3LDoRUHJpotDQzEoQf4VpbebDjB
transaction
5cd61a3f6fba80c6f6b91ac63188c050dd31e82396304b590a8b864a51b43df9
confirmations
300959
spent
true